Four indoor hard courts at the city-run gym, with portable nets on permanent lines. Current drop-in open play runs Tuesdays and Thursdays, noon–3pm, $4 for adults and $2 for youth and seniors, registered through the city's online catalog. You may also see a separate Monday evening session listed, 7–9pm, flat $4, with a house coach for beginners — that program may be outdated, so plan around the Tuesday/Thursday schedule and confirm the current catalog before heading over.
